Kontarnoye in the region of Donets'ka is a place in Ukraine - some 396 mi or ( 637 km ) South-East of Kiev , the country's capital city .

Dymytrov

Dymytrov or Dmitrov is a city in Donetsk Oblast of Ukraine. Population is 54,787 (2001). The city was named after Georgi Dimitrov - a prominent Bulgarian communist politician.

Mius River

Mius is a river in Eastern Europe that flows through Ukraine and Russia. It starts in the Donets Range of Donetsk Oblast and flows through Luhansk Oblast, Ukraine and Rostov Oblast, Russia into the Mius Firth of the Sea of Azov, west of Taganrog. Its length is 258 km. During the World War II the Germans created a heavily fortified line, known as Miusfront or Mius-Front, that was an arena of fierce battles during the Battle of Rostov (1943).
